Factors Influencing Model Salaries

Several factors play a crucial role in determining a model’s salary. These factors can be broadly categorized into three main areas:

  • Experience: Experience is a significant factor in determining a model’s earning potential. Models with a proven track record and a strong portfolio typically command higher fees than those who are just starting out.
  • Type of Modeling: The type of modeling a model engages in also influences their salary. Runway models, who walk in fashion shows, generally earn more than commercial models, who appear in print ads and commercials. Editorial fashion models, who work on high-end fashion magazines, can also command substantial fees.
  • Location: The location where a model works can also impact their salary. Models working in major fashion capitals like New York, Paris, and Milan typically earn more than those working in smaller markets.

Salary Ranges for Different Types of Modeling

To provide a clearer understanding of modeling salaries, here’s a breakdown of average earnings for different types of modeling:

  • Runway Modeling: Runway models can earn anywhere from $250 to $5,000 per show, with top models commanding fees in the tens of thousands of dollars.
  • Commercial Modeling: Commercial models typically earn $125 to $175 per hour, with rates increasing for more experienced models and higher-profile campaigns.
  • Editorial Fashion Modeling: Editorial fashion models can earn $100 to $200 per hour, with top models commanding fees in the range of $500 to $2,000 per day.

Who is the Highest Paid Model?

1. Kendall Jenner

Kendall Jenner is the reigning queen of the modeling world, having topped the Forbes list of highest-paid models for five consecutive years. With an estimated annual income of $40 million, Jenner’s wealth stems from her lucrative contracts with brands like Estee Lauder, Calvin Klein, and Adidas. Her reality TV stardom and social media influence further amplify her earning potential.

2. Rosie Huntington-Whiteley

Rosie Huntington-Whiteley is a British model and businesswoman with an estimated net worth of $32 million. She’s known for her work with Victoria’s Secret, Burberry, and Agent Provocateur, and has also ventured into acting and fashion design.

3. Gisele Bündchen

Gisele Bündchen is a Brazilian model who has been a dominant force in the industry for over two decades. She’s the highest-paid model of all time, having earned over $400 million throughout her career. Bündchen’s work with Victoria’s Secret, Chanel, and Dior cemented her status as a fashion icon.

4. Cara Delevingne

Cara Delevingne is a British model and actress with an estimated net worth of $31 million. She’s known for her edgy style and has walked for brands like Burberry, Chanel, and Versace. Delevingne has also ventured into acting, appearing in films like “Suicide Squad” and “Paper Towns.”
